Versa and Strava not syncing

Replies are disabled for this topic. Start a new one or visit our Help Center.

i have tried everything to get them to sync, since the update when i go into strava sync it to fibit it shows then when you close the strava app and open it again the sync is gone and you can keep doing this every **ahem** time.

It's pretty weird that Fitbit and Strava aren't linking. I would like you to go to your Dashboard and then revoke access to Strava by doing the following: 

  1. Tap the Today tab 
     
    , and tap your profile picture. 
  2. Scroll down and tap Manage Data > Manage 3rd Party Apps.
  3. Log in to your Fitbit account.
  4. Tap Revoke Access to disconnect an app from your Fitbit account. 

After this restart your phone and follow the linking procedure

When I visit https://strava.fitbit.com/ a few days after I have already clicked "Connect" I always get the ....prompt to "connect" (again).
However, I've come to understand that this is just a "display" bug, because in spite of that, my Fitbit sync to Strava works fine without issues (for GPS - enabled only activities), so in reality is is already connected.

I think you can get a more clear and real picture of what's happening if you visit https://www.fitbit.com/settings/applications . There you can see if Strava is really connected to Fitbit.
